Detailed analysis of the SEAT León 1.9 TDI 105 CV DPF DSG Stylance (2007)

General description

The 2005 SEAT León 1.9 TDI 105 CV DPF DSG Stylance is a compact car that combines the efficiency of a diesel engine with the comfort of a DSG automatic transmission. This model, with its distinctive design and Stylance equipment, positioned itself as an attractive option for those looking for a versatile car with a sporty touch for everyday use.

Driving experience

Behind the wheel, the León 1.9 TDI 105 CV offers a balanced driving experience. The diesel engine, although not a powerhouse, delivers a torque of 250 Nm at 1900 rpm that feels energetic in most situations, especially during acceleration. The 6-speed DSG gearbox is a delight, with smooth and fast transitions that improve comfort and efficiency. The suspension, McPherson type at the front and deformable parallelogram at the rear, provides a good compromise between comfort and stability, allowing corners to be taken with confidence without sacrificing comfort on long journeys. The rack-and-pinion steering, although not the most communicative, performs its function accurately. Overall, it is a car that invites you to enjoy the road with a sense of control and composure.

Design and aesthetics

The design of the 2005 SEAT León, by Walter de Silva, marked a before and after for the brand. Its fluid and dynamic lines, with a silhouette that evokes movement, give it a strong and recognizable personality. The sharp headlights and distinctive grille give it an aggressive yet elegant look. In the 5-door version, practicality is combined with aesthetics, creating a harmonious whole. The interior, although sober, is well resolved, with quality materials and ergonomics designed for the driver. The 341-liter trunk, although not the largest in its segment, is sufficient for daily use.

Technology and features

In terms of technology, this SEAT León incorporates elements that, for its time, were quite advanced. The 1.9 TDI engine with direct injection via unit injector, variable geometry turbo, and intercooler is an example of diesel efficiency. The dual-clutch DSG transmission, one of the first to become popular, offered a smoothness and speed in gear changes that few rivals could match. In terms of safety, it had ventilated disc brakes at the front and discs at the rear, and a well-tuned suspension that contributed to safe dynamic behavior. Although it lacks modern driving aids, its technological base was solid and reliable.

Competition

In the competitive compact segment, the SEAT León 1.9 TDI 105 CV faced tough rivals such as the Volkswagen Golf, Ford Focus, Opel Astra, and Renault Mégane. Compared to them, the León stood out for its more passionate design, its excellent DSG gearbox, and an attractive price-quality ratio. While the Golf could offer greater interior refinement and the Focus a sportier driving dynamic, the León positioned itself as a balanced option with its own character that made it stand out.
